标签: cuda
您能说明如何使用CUDA计算可以驻留在特定GPU中的最大线程数吗?即我可以分配给内核的最大线程数。谢谢!
答案 0 :(得分:1)
您可以使用cudaGetDeviceProperties()获取每个多处理器(SM)的最大线程数。然后将其乘以卡片中的SM数量。
cudaGetDeviceProperties()
虽然这并不一定意味着你应该执行这个数量的线程。请参阅a good explanation的这个SO答案。